随着云计算的兴起,越来越多的人开始选择将自己的网站或应用托管在云服务器上。而作为一名菜鸟级别的云服务器使用者,有没有想过如何搭建自己的云服务器呢?本文将以腾讯云服务器为例,为大家介绍如何搭建LAMP(Linux Apache MySQL PHP)环境,希望能对菜鸟级别的用户有所帮助。
第一部分:购买腾讯云服务器
1. 登录腾讯云官网并注册账号;
2. 进入腾讯云管理控制台;
3. 选择云服务器,点击\”创建实例\”;
4. 按照引导选择合适的配置,如地域、操作系统、网络等;
5. 设置登录密码并完成购买。
第二部分:登录云服务器
1. 在腾讯云管理控制台,找到已创建的云服务器实例;
2. 获取远程连接工具,如Windows用户可使用Xshell,Mac用户可使用Terminal;
3. 打开连接工具,输入云服务器的公网IP地址、用户名、密码,完成登录。
第三部分:配置LAMP环境
1. 更新系统和软件包:
– 在终端或Xshell中输入命令 `sudo apt update`,更新系统
– 输入命令 `sudo apt upgrade`,升级软件包
2. 安装Apache:
– 输入命令 `sudo apt install apache2`,安装Apache
– 输入命令 `sudo systemctl start apache2`,启动Apache
– 打开浏览器,输入云服务器的公网IP地址,应该能看到Apache的默认页面
3. 安装MySQL:
– 输入命令 `sudo apt install mysql-server`,安装MySQL
– 输入命令 `sudo systemctl start mysql`,启动MySQL
– 输入命令 `sudo mysql_secure_installation`,进行MySQL安全设置
4. 安装PHP:
– 输入命令 `sudo apt install php libapache2-mod-php php-mysql`,安装PHP及其相关模块
– 输入命令 `sudo systemctl restart apache2`,重启Apache以使PHP模块生效
5. 测试LAMP环境:
– 在云服务器的Apache默认网站目录中创建一个PHP文件,如\”info.php\”
– 输入命令 `sudo nano /var/www/html/info.php`,编辑PHP文件,插入以下内容:“
– 保存并退出编辑器,输入命令 `sudo systemctl restart apache2`,重启Apache
– 打开浏览器,输入云服务器的公网IP地址后加上\”/info.php\”,应该能看到PHP环境的详细信息
第四部分:进一步配置与管理
1. 配置防火墙:
– 在腾讯云控制台,找到已创建的云服务器实例,点击\”安全组\”;
– 点击\”入站规则\”,添加规则并开放HTTP(端口80)和HTTPS(端口443);
– 点击\”应用到云服务器\”,保存设置。
2. 配置域名和虚拟主机:
– 在域名注册商处将域名解析到云服务器的公网IP地址;
– 在云服务器中配置虚拟主机,以支持多个域名/网站。可以参考Apache的配置文件 \”/etc/apache2/sites-available/\”。
3. 数据库管理:
– 使用MySQL的命令行工具或图形化管理工具,如phpMyAdmin,管理数据库和用户账号。
4. 定期备份和更新:
– 设置定期备份云服务器中的数据,以防止数据丢失;
– 定期更新软件包和系统以保持系统安全性。
结论
通过本文的介绍,我们可以看到即使是菜鸟级别的用户,也可以轻松地搭建腾讯云服务器上的LAMP环境。LAMP环境是部署网站和应用的基础,并且在云服务器上具有高度的灵活性和可定制性。希望本文能够对初次搭建云服务器的用户有所帮助,让你轻松享受云计算的便利和优势。无论是个人网站还是企业应用,都可以在腾讯云服务器上实现稳定、高效的运行。
免责声明:本站发布的内容(图片、视频和文字)以原创、转载和分享为主,文章观点不代表本网站立场,如果涉及侵权请联系站长邮箱:ninezy@qq.com 进行举报,并提供相关证据,一经查实,将立刻删除涉嫌侵权内容。